MFL5: Clann na nGael reach decider

May 19, 2015

Eamon Ó Donnchadha - Clann Na nGael

Clann na nGael 3-18
Dunderry 1-9


The scoreline does not reflect what was in fact a keenly contested minor semi final between these two neighbours in Athboy on Monday evening.

Clann seemed to find scores easy to come by and with Goalkeeper Gary Kelly in outstanding form for Clann Na nGael they built up an early lead.

Clann na nGael went in to an early lead through points from Cian Swaine and Rory Tuite and when Tuite took a quick free to set up Calum Ennis for Clanns first goal the Athboy/Rathcairn lads led by 4 points approaching half time.

A sweeping attacking move led to a Rory Smith goal just before half time which left the half time score Clann na nGael 2-6 to 0-4.

The second half began with Dunderry enjoying a strong wind at their backs and they looked to make a game of it getting two quick points .A point from County Minor Eamon Ó Donnchadha settled Clann a bit but when the Dunderry lads got a goal to leave just 4 points in it anything could have happened.

But it was not to be for Dunderry, Eamon Ó Donnchadha took over at midfield and began some great Clann na nGael attacks with surging runs from deep. One of these runs set up Rory Tuite for a third Clann na nGael goal and with points from Cian Swaine, Calum Ennis and Ó Donnchadha Clann na nGael finished strongly to qualify for a final meeting with neighbours Gaeil Colmcille which will be played after the exams.
